Traditionally shaped fank, Glen Almond
The circular stone walls that are such a familiar feature of the sheep farming landscape are rarely used now. Here is a modern update, that shows that the circular fank is still going strong. Galvanised sheets replace the dry stane dyking, but the shape is the same.
